Fun Fact #2 | Entry numbers – cars and drivers – over the years.

Here are some numbers for you:
In 2019, 79 drivers, in 38 cars, started the inaugural #Sydney300.

In 2021, the return of the event, after the 2020 race was a victim of the COVID pandemic, saw 79 drivers contest the race, in what was a 40-car field that greeted the starter.

The numbers increased to 43 cars, 84 drivers in 2022.

Last year, 94 drivers, in 48 cars, took part in the biggest Pitcher Partners Sydney 300 to date.

Last year’s field holds several records;

  • It was the most number of cars and drivers to contest the race.
  • We saw a record 7 solo driver efforts, and a record number of entries field three drivers (5), and

Over the years, no less than 217 drivers have competed in a Sydney 300 (that number includes drivers who may not have got to actually drive in the 77-lap race itself, due to the car they were scheduled to drive retiring along the way… sorry Maisie Place Motorsport).
Incidentally, a whopping 136 drivers have only started ONE of the four 300’s at Sydney Motorsport Park, and there’ll be a post dedicated to some of those one-hit wonders in the weeks to come.
However, of those 217, only thirteen of the original field (the class of 2019) has four Sydney 300 starts to their name!
